REplace Secures $2.1 Million to Propel AI-Driven Site Selection in Renewable Energy
In a significant boost for the renewable energy sector, REplace has announced a successful funding round totaling $2.1 million. This funding will accelerate the growth of REplace’s innovative platform, which utilizes artificial intelligence to streamline site selection for renewable energy and data center projects. By revolutionizing the way developers evaluate potential sites, REplace aims to enhance efficiency and reduce the time taken for site assessments, ultimately contributing to a quicker rollout of clean energy solutions.
Transforming Site Selection with AI
REplace operates on the premise that optimal site selection is crucial for maximizing return on investment (ROI) and minimizing project risks. The platform leverages proprietary algorithms that analyze a myriad of factors—from land ownership and grid connectivity to permitting risks and market conditions. This advanced technology allows REplace to compress traditionally lengthy site assessment timelines from months into mere seconds, thus facilitating faster decisions. This transformation is particularly essential in an industry where delays can lead to significant financial losses and project withdrawals.

Addressing Industry Challenges
The funding could not have come at a more critical time. The renewable energy landscape has been facing challenges, with a staggering 80% of proposed clean energy projects being abandoned due to delays in siting, permitting, and interconnection processes. The 2024 global investment in low-carbon energy hit a record $2.1 trillion, indicating a growing demand for quicker, smarter deployment of energy solutions. Despite this momentum, many projects continue to falter at the initial stages.
REplace aims to counter this trend. By enabling teams to shift from tedious manual processes to instantaneous intelligence, the platform positions itself as an essential tool for developers looking to streamline operations and enhance productivity in a highly competitive market.
A Growing Ecosystem of Support
The recent funding round was led by Gravity Climate, an influential player in the climate tech space whose founding team includes notable figures like Dr. Bracha Halaf and Zafrir Yoeli. Yoeli highlighted the revolutionary aspects of REplace’s technology, stating, “Their platform not only accelerates project timelines but also fosters smarter, low-risk development at scale. In a world racing to meet net-zero goals, platforms like REplace are essential infrastructure.”
Additional investors include Adam/a, a climate tech fund backed by Crescendo Partners, and various strategic angels from the solar and data center sectors. This support underscores the confidence that industry leaders have in REplace's potential to transform the renewable energy and data center landscape.
